This exceptional office space, located at 1310 Tutor Ln in Evansville, Indiana, presents a fantastic opportunity for businesses seeking a well-situated and versatile workspace. The single-story, 2,300 to 2,500 square foot building, constructed in 1996, is a traditional office space perfect for a variety of professional uses. Situated in Vanderburgh County (APN 82-06-24-016-131.001-027), this property benefits from a convenient location in Evansville's thriving east side, specifically within the N Burkhardt Road area. The C-2 zoning allows for a range of commercial activities. The building's single-story design offers easy accessibility, and ample parking is available for clients and employees. This is a multi-tenant building, with one space currently available. The property's strategic location places it near a variety of retail establishments and other professional businesses, ensuring high visibility and convenient access for clients.
